Winnipeg Sun: Cole Perfetti isn’t going to be elite at faceoffs right away, and that’s OK. One thing we’ve been able to observe is his eagerness to learn. After formal skates concluded going up against the bigger and stronger Adam Lowry in order to work on that element of his game.

Winnipeg Sun: Nikolaj Ehlers tired of asking himself, ‘Why me?’. To hear him say “I just want to play 82 games” somewhat wistfully yesterday shows how much it weighs on him the inability to play a full season and show what he is capable of bringing each and every game.

Winnipeg Free Press: Ehlers eager to put injury-plagued season in the rear-view mirror. (Paywall). He did have back-to-back 82 game seasons in 2016-17 and 2017-18. You could hear it in his voice speaking to how much work he put in during the summer only to be dealing with something like this although as he spun it, at least it is the preseason.
